§ 58-70a-302 — Qualifications for licensure.

Each applicant for licensure as a physician assistant shall:
(1)submit an application in a form the division approves;
(2)pay a fee determined by the department under Section 63J-1-504;
(3)have successfully completed a physician assistant program accredited by:
(3)(a) the Accreditation Review Commission on Education for the Physician Assistant; or
(3)(b) if before January 1, 2001, either the:
(3)(b)(i) Committee on Accreditation of Allied Health Education Programs; or
(3)(b)(ii) Committee on Allied Health Education and Accreditation;
(4)have passed the licensing examinations required by division rule made in collaboration with the board;
(5)meet with the board and representatives of the division, if requested, for the purpose of evaluating the applicant's qualifications for licensure;
